| Cas Number | 123-75-1 |
| Molecular Formula | C4H9N |
| Molar Mass | 71.12 g/mol |
| Appearance | Colorless liquid |
| Odor | Amine-like |
| Density | 0.866 g/cm3 |
| Melting Point | -63°C |
| Boiling Point | 87°C |
| Solubility In Water | Miscible |
| Flash Point | 10°C |
| Refractive Index | 1.442 |
| Vapor Pressure | 62 mmHg (20°C) |

| Shipping | Pyrrolidine should be shipped in tightly sealed containers, stored upright in a cool, well-ventilated area away from ignition sources. It is classified as a flammable and corrosive substance; appropriate hazard labels and documentation are required. Transport must comply with national and international regulations for hazardous chemicals. Handle with compatible protective materials. |
| Storage | Pyrrolidine should be stored in a tightly closed container, in a cool, dry, and well-ventilated area away from sources of ignition. Keep it away from incompatible materials such as acids, oxidizers, and moisture. Store under inert atmosphere if possible, as it is sensitive to air and may degrade. Ensure proper labeling and secure storage to prevent leaks or spills. |
